Finance Review Summary — Legacy Pricing

Torvane Systems will raise rates for legacy Corvid-platform customers by 9% effective Q2. Modelled churn is under 3%; net revenue uplift projected at 2.1M annually. Communications are drafted and legal has cleared the contract language. The strategic reasoning behind the timing is set out below.

confidential, kagup-bafog: Fraaxax Group is in early talks to buy Soroxox Group for about $343.8 million. The Olidor launch date is June 14, and nothing goes to the press before then. Legal wants the Aldmirek Logistics term sheet signed before July 23.

## Provenance: Marrowdiff Large-File Viewer

For the weekly eng sync: the Marrowdiff viewer build is now fully traceable from source to artifact. Chunked rendering for files over 80 MB shipped in this cycle, with provenance records stored per release. The attestation token for the current build appears below.

session token of tajef-bageg = htk21_5d90d574934f3ccae6437

Finance Review — Second-Source Supplier Search

Short version for the sales leads: we're still too dependent on Corvane Plastics for the Altrix housings, so finance greenlit a second-source hunt. Three candidates shortlisted — Bellmere Moulding looks strongest on price, Quarrow Industries on lead time. Dual-sourcing should trim unit cost about 4% by autumn and kill the single-point-of-failure risk customers keep asking about. Keep this out of customer conversations for now. Here's the confidential bit on where we're headed.

board note of fafog-yahap: Project Rusdor slips by a full year because of the audit delay.

This PR reworks the Tallbridge fleet fuel-usage report to aggregate per-depot rather than per-vehicle, fixing the double-counting seen in the Ashgrove rollout. All figures were cross-checked against last quarter's manual audit. Please review the smoothing and outlier thresholds carefully, as they directly affect the published numbers.

constants for fawep-yagap:
QUOTAS = {
    "noveth": 275,
    "oliion": 740,
}